I understood that synergistic dance between photographer and object - 'muse,' if you will, 'model,' whatever you call us. It's that silent language of communication, like being psychic with each other.
Carmen Dell'Orefice

Interpretation

What this quote means

The quote emphasizes the deep, often unspoken connection between a photographer and their subject.

Carmen Dell'Orefice highlights the unique relationship between a photographer and their muse or model, suggesting that there is an intuitive understanding and silent communication that transcends words. This synergy allows for a more profound and authentic expression of creativity in the art of photography.
